Israel Adesanya: A Brief Bio

Full NameIsrael Adesanya
BornJuly 22, 1989, Lagos, Nigeria
Height6 ft 4 in (193 cm)
Weight ClassMiddleweight
TeamCity Kickboxing (Auckland, New Zealand)
UFC TitleFormer UFC Middleweight Champion
Notable WinsKelvin Gastelum (UFC 236), Robert Whittaker (x2)
Current Streak2 losses in a row (Imavov, Du Plessis)

Israel Adesanya is one of the most recognizable names in the UFC today. Born in Nigeria and raised in New Zealand, he rose to fame through his unmatched striking skills and engaging personality. His journey in MMA started after a successful kickboxing career, and he quickly climbed the ranks in the UFC, becoming the middleweight champion.
